Posted on 1/16/24 at 12:49 pm to Nguyener
quote:
We need a party for those of us who are small government conservatives.
I'd be interested in how you believe you get that done.
You can form all the parties you want, but if you caucus and vote with the republicans you are eventually co-opted or destroyed by the republican establishment. (see: Tea Party)
You can remain independent from the republican party, nominating your own candidates for each office. However, you would be able to gauge your success by how many marxist democrats win those elections. Success would mean veto proof majorities for the marxists in any body you want to name, as the republican vote is split.
Or, you can vote for the most conservative candidate who has a chance to win, just like most of us has resigned to do. I decided long ago that the extent of my protest against the establishment republicans will be to vote for a third party conservative only when I know that the marxist cannot win, or when the idiot republicans nominate another establishment shitbag that I simply cannot vote for. (see: Haley)
